    My M11/9 sold in 15 minutes on gunbroker today and the buyer lives in Pennsylvania. I know I have to ship to a class3 dealer and I will have to have a copy of his FFL first before I ship.
    my question is , what paperwork do I need to do? I guess I could ask him but the more advice I get the better.
    do I have to get anything from ATF first? or will all of that be handled by the buyers class3 dealer that I ship this to

    OK i think I got it. I think I have to wait on ATF to return the paperwork [ form 4? ] before I can ship to the class 3 dealer and then the buyer has to wait for the class 3 dealer to get his paperwork back before he can pick up the MG
    wow this poor guy may have to wait a year! am I right?

    Wrong, use ATF Form 3 for transfers to dealers. Form 4's have some sort of tax paid.

    http://www.atf.gov/forms/download/atf-f-5320-3.pdf

    Once the dealer in PA has it then he can start the form 4 on the individual.

    Sure?

    I was under the impression that a Form 3 was for Dealer to Dealer.

    Individual/trust to a Dealer is still a Form 4.

    It would seem the OP was correct, unless he's a Dealer.

    I asked a friend who is a Class 3 dealer and this is what he said i do before I ship it to the class 3 dealer

    " You will need to get the approved form 4 back from NFA first. (Only the front needs to be filled out to the dealer) "

    Nevermind you do use the form 4. I just checked this ATF faq.

    http://www.atf.gov/publications/download/p/atf-p-5320-8/atf-p-5320-8-chapter-9.pdf

    The form 3 is for FFL to FFL. The way the forms are written can be somewhat confusing and ambiguous. By the way according to the above faq, you do have to pay a transfer tax since you don't have an FFL/SOT. The good news it that the transfer time won't take long since its going to an FFL.
